National law firm has a brand new opening and we are seeking motivated, professional candidates to join our team! The successful candidate will support attorneys in litigation law, including commercial litigation and general litigation.

We offer an outstanding benefits package, including medical, dental, vision, 401K, disability, life insurance, educational reimbursement, generous PTO and much more!

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Exercises independent judgment in determining priority levels of all work assigned on a daily basis. Assures that high priority items are completed in a timely manner.
  • Types, transcribes, revises, modifies and proofreads all correspondence, memoranda, notes, outlines, legal documents, charts, forms, etc., whether from drafts, originals or dictation; prioritizes assignments and meets specific deadlines on projects.
  • Responsible for all electronic and non-electronic filings with various courts (state and federal) and tribunals.
  • Processes conflict clearance requests for new and existing clients and matters into new business intake (Elegrity) software system. Prepares and submits conflict check screening forms and new matter request forms through Elegrity. Drafts engagement letters.
  • Maintains and coordinates attorneys' calendars; communicates with attorneys regarding scheduling.
  • Makes travel arrangements and prepares itineraries.
  • Initiates or gathers pertinent materials needed for assignments from files, Records Department, Legal Information Services, file share services, etc. Downloads court filings, transcripts, records, document productions, etc., and saves to document management system (NetDocs).
  • Reviews and routes incoming mail not marked personal and confidential, if requested to do so. Prepares and processes outgoing mail, arranging for specialized mail or messenger services as required. Ensures all attachments, exhibits, and enclosures are included. Coordinates activities with Office Services, as needed.
  • Answers and screens telephone calls. Assists callers independently on a regular basis. Exhibits the discretion to know when to contact the attorney concerning urgent or emergency calls and when to refer to another party.
  • Enters and/or releases attorneys' time, if required. Maintains list of all current billing numbers for assigned timekeepers. Assists billing coordinators with billing/e-billing questions/procedures.
  • Prepares and submits invoices and expense reports.
  • Maintains and organizes digital and hard files on request, working in conjunction with Records Department.
  • Assists other administrative assistants with work overflow.
  • Perform other responsibilities/tasks as requested.

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ITIES REQUIRED

  • High school diploma or GED required; one to two years of post-high school education preferred.
  • Three to five years of legal support experience, with strong Real Estate and litigation skills, required. Experience in additional practice areas is a plus.
  • Proficient in state and federal court electronic filing procedures, including MiFile (MI) and PACER. Knowledge of state and federal court rules regarding discovery, motion practice, and general procedures helpful.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, including Word (styles and tables), Outlook, Excel and PowerPoint. Knowledge of NetDocuments, Elegrity, File Trail and Chrome River helpful. Ability to use a redlining tool.
  • Excellent written (including via email) and verbal communication skills, including grammar, spelling and proofreading.
  • High level of organizational skills, with ability to multi-task and independently meet deadlines.
  • Ability to deliver superior, professional services to all internal and external clients.
  • Ability to maintain a high degree of discretion and confidentiality regarding client information, documents and conversations.
  • Flexibility to work overtime when required.
  • Typing speed of 55 WPM or greater.
